remove playlist from news model
This commit is contained in:
parent
7b10a71cf6
commit
636bc43a35
|
|
@ -26,7 +26,7 @@ class BaseTestCase(APITestCase):
|
||||||
self.test_news = News.objects.create(created_by=self.user, modified_by=self.user, title={"en-GB": "Test news"},
|
self.test_news = News.objects.create(created_by=self.user, modified_by=self.user, title={"en-GB": "Test news"},
|
||||||
news_type=self.test_news_type,
|
news_type=self.test_news_type,
|
||||||
description={"en-GB": "Description test news"},
|
description={"en-GB": "Description test news"},
|
||||||
playlist=1, start="2020-12-03 12:00:00", end="2020-12-13 12:00:00",
|
start="2020-12-03 12:00:00", end="2020-12-13 12:00:00",
|
||||||
state=News.PUBLISHED, slug='test-news')
|
state=News.PUBLISHED, slug='test-news')
|
||||||
|
|
||||||
self.test_content_type = ContentType.objects.get(app_label="news", model="news")
|
self.test_content_type = ContentType.objects.get(app_label="news", model="news")
|
||||||
|
|
|
||||||
17
apps/news/migrations/0027_remove_news_playlist.py
Normal file
17
apps/news/migrations/0027_remove_news_playlist.py
Normal file
|
|
@ -0,0 +1,17 @@
|
||||||
|
# Generated by Django 2.2.4 on 2019-10-24 09:37
|
||||||
|
|
||||||
|
from django.db import migrations
|
||||||
|
|
||||||
|
|
||||||
|
class Migration(migrations.Migration):
|
||||||
|
|
||||||
|
dependencies = [
|
||||||
|
('news', '0026_auto_20191024_0913'),
|
||||||
|
]
|
||||||
|
|
||||||
|
operations = [
|
||||||
|
migrations.RemoveField(
|
||||||
|
model_name='news',
|
||||||
|
name='playlist',
|
||||||
|
),
|
||||||
|
]
|
||||||
|
|
@ -141,7 +141,6 @@ class News(BaseAttributes, TranslatedFieldsMixin):
|
||||||
verbose_name=_('End'))
|
verbose_name=_('End'))
|
||||||
slug = models.SlugField(unique=True, max_length=255,
|
slug = models.SlugField(unique=True, max_length=255,
|
||||||
verbose_name=_('News slug'))
|
verbose_name=_('News slug'))
|
||||||
playlist = models.IntegerField(_('playlist'))
|
|
||||||
state = models.PositiveSmallIntegerField(default=WAITING, choices=STATE_CHOICES,
|
state = models.PositiveSmallIntegerField(default=WAITING, choices=STATE_CHOICES,
|
||||||
verbose_name=_('State'))
|
verbose_name=_('State'))
|
||||||
is_highlighted = models.BooleanField(default=False,
|
is_highlighted = models.BooleanField(default=False,
|
||||||
|
|
|
||||||
|
|
@ -179,7 +179,6 @@ class NewsDetailSerializer(NewsBaseSerializer):
|
||||||
'description_translated',
|
'description_translated',
|
||||||
'start',
|
'start',
|
||||||
'end',
|
'end',
|
||||||
'playlist',
|
|
||||||
'is_publish',
|
'is_publish',
|
||||||
'state',
|
'state',
|
||||||
'state_display',
|
'state_display',
|
||||||
|
|
|
||||||
|
|
@ -50,7 +50,7 @@ class BaseTestCase(APITestCase):
|
||||||
title={"en-GB": "Test news"},
|
title={"en-GB": "Test news"},
|
||||||
news_type=self.test_news_type,
|
news_type=self.test_news_type,
|
||||||
description={"en-GB": "Description test news"},
|
description={"en-GB": "Description test news"},
|
||||||
playlist=1, start=datetime.now() + timedelta(hours=-2),
|
start=datetime.now() + timedelta(hours=-2),
|
||||||
end=datetime.now() + timedelta(hours=2),
|
end=datetime.now() + timedelta(hours=2),
|
||||||
state=News.PUBLISHED, slug='test-news-slug',
|
state=News.PUBLISHED, slug='test-news-slug',
|
||||||
country=self.country_ru)
|
country=self.country_ru)
|
||||||
|
|
@ -85,7 +85,6 @@ class NewsTestCase(BaseTestCase):
|
||||||
'description': {"en-GB": "Description test news!"},
|
'description': {"en-GB": "Description test news!"},
|
||||||
'slug': self.test_news.slug,
|
'slug': self.test_news.slug,
|
||||||
'start': self.test_news.start,
|
'start': self.test_news.start,
|
||||||
'playlist': self.test_news.playlist,
|
|
||||||
'news_type_id':self.test_news.news_type_id,
|
'news_type_id':self.test_news.news_type_id,
|
||||||
'country_id': self.country_ru.id
|
'country_id': self.country_ru.id
|
||||||
}
|
}
|
||||||
|
|
|
||||||
|
|
@ -37,7 +37,6 @@ class NewsDocument(Document):
|
||||||
model = models.News
|
model = models.News
|
||||||
fields = (
|
fields = (
|
||||||
'id',
|
'id',
|
||||||
'playlist',
|
|
||||||
'start',
|
'start',
|
||||||
'end',
|
'end',
|
||||||
'slug',
|
'slug',
|
||||||
|
|
|
||||||
|
|
@ -47,7 +47,6 @@ class TranslateFieldTests(BaseTestCase):
|
||||||
"ru-RU": "Тестовая новость"
|
"ru-RU": "Тестовая новость"
|
||||||
},
|
},
|
||||||
description={"en-GB": "Test description"},
|
description={"en-GB": "Test description"},
|
||||||
playlist=1,
|
|
||||||
start=datetime.now(pytz.utc) + timedelta(hours=-13),
|
start=datetime.now(pytz.utc) + timedelta(hours=-13),
|
||||||
end=datetime.now(pytz.utc) + timedelta(hours=13),
|
end=datetime.now(pytz.utc) + timedelta(hours=13),
|
||||||
news_type=self.news_type,
|
news_type=self.news_type,
|
||||||
|
|
|
||||||
Loading…
Reference in New Issue
Block a user